Are Kashmir Willow bats good?

A Kashmir Willow cricket bat is best suited when the ball used is softer than the hard leather ball. In such a scenario, the difference between a Kashmir Willow and English Willow is not noticeable as the ball used is not hard enough

Can kashmir be visited in August?

Best time to visit Kashmir is during the months of March to August. Tourists come to Kashmir valley so they too can witness this 'heaven on earth' and enjoy all that it offers. During this period two seasons are covered in Kashmir. Spring (March to early May) and Summer (early May to late August).

How Kashmir became part of India?

Post independence, the princely state didn’t join either India or Pakistan. When Pakistan attacked Kashmir, Raja Hari Singh who was the ruler decided to join India upon which he was asked to sign the Instrument of Accession.

By executing an Instrument of Accession under the provisions of the Indian Independence Act 1947, Maharaja Hari Singh agreed to accede his state to the Dominion of India. On 27 October 1947, the then Governor-General of India, Lord Mountbatten accepted the accession. After that Kashmir legally became part of India.

How Kashmir issue started?

The conflict started after the partition of India in 1947 when Maharaja Hari Singh signed the instrument of accession with India but still Pakistan claimed the entirety of the former princely state of Jammu and Kashmir. It is a dispute over the region that escalated into three wars between India and Pakistan and several other armed skirmishes.

How Kashmir got its name ?

The name "Kashmir" means "desiccated land" (from the Sanskrit: ka = water and shimīra = desiccate). In the Rajatarangini, a history of Kashmir written by Kalhana in the mid-12th century, it is stated that the valley of Kashmir was formerly a lake which got dried up.
